It&#8217;s been more than 10 years since the release of the newest game in the <em>Batman Arkham<\/em> trilogy, but there&#8217;s something to be said about appreciation for the classics. Rocksteady Studios&#8217; pack of <em>Batman <\/em>games has stood the test of time, providing a great choice for players who&#8217;ve never tried them before.<\/p>\n<p>This bundle of games includes the Game of the Year editions for <em>Batman: Arkham Asylum<\/em> and <em>Batman: Arkham City<\/em>, along with <em>Batman: Arkham Knight<\/em> and its season pass. Two out of the three have &#8220;Overwhelming Positive&#8221; scores on Steam, and <em>Arkham Knight<\/em> isn&#8217;t far off that mark. Altogether, that&#8217;s a value of almost $80, which would practically wipe out the hypothetical $100 budget if the sale weren&#8217;t on.<\/p>\n<p>    <!-- No AdsNinja v10 Client! --><\/p>\n<h2 id=\"dispatch---26-99-10-off\">\n            <span class=\"item-num\">6 <\/span><br \/>\n        <span><br \/>\n                            Dispatch &#8211; $26.99 (10% Off)<br \/>\n                    <\/span><br \/>\n       <\/h2>\n<p>The Steam discount on <em>Dispatch<\/em> is much less significant, but it only came out a few months ago, so that&#8217;s understandable. A combination of an interactive animated movie and a chaos simulator, <em>Dispatch <\/em>has players stepping into the role of Robert Robertson III, a former superhero turned emergency dispatcher for a bunch of misfit ex-villains trying to turn their lives around.<\/p>\n<p>Released in eight episodes between October 22 and November 12, it&#8217;s got a 97 percent approval rating on Steam, and while the discount isn&#8217;t that big compared to other games on the list, it still takes a little chunk out of the regular $29.99 price tag for such a highly rated recent release. It&#8217;s also got a stellar cast, featuring the talents of Aaron Paul and Laura Bailey, plus a bunch of social media stars like Yung Gravy, Thot Squad, jacksepticeye, and MoistCr1TiKaL, who provide laugh-out-loud moments in the epic superhero story.<\/p>\n<p>    <!-- No AdsNinja v10 Client! --><\/p>\n<h2 id=\"hades---7-49-70-off\">\n            <span class=\"item-num\">5 <\/span><br \/>\n        <span><br \/>\n                            Hades &#8211; $7.49 (70% Off)<br \/>\n                    <\/span><br \/>\n       <\/h2>\n<p><em>Hades 2<\/em> is one of the best video games of 2025 in a lot of players&#8217; minds, but the first game in the series is certainly nothing to scoff at for anyone who hasn&#8217;t picked it up yet. Since its release in September 2020, <em>Hades<\/em> has racked up more than 136,000 reviews on Steam, and 95 percent of players have walked away leaving it a positive review, putting it just a tick below the popularity of its much more recent sequel (which is also available for 25 percent off during the Winter Sale).<\/p>\n<p>That&#8217;s a great performance for Supergiant Games&#8217; roguelite, which packs a ton of high-energy action into an engaging story. The Steam discount for <em>Hades<\/em> is also a great offer for those who dove headfirst into the second game without playing the first.<\/p>\n<p>    <!-- No AdsNinja v10 Client! --><\/p>\n<h2 id=\"blue-prince---19-79-34-off\">\n            <span class=\"item-num\">4 <\/span><br \/>\n        <span><br \/>\n                            Blue Prince &#8211; $19.79 (34% Off)<br \/>\n                    <\/span><br \/>\n       <\/h2>\n<p>There have been many stellar indie games released in 2025, and <em>Blue Prince<\/em> is easily counted among them. The debut entry for solo developer Tonda Ros, the mansion-crawling puzzle game took about eight years to create, and players can feel the love put into it over time as they place and explore its wide array of rooms to try to unlock the secrets of the Mount Holly Estate.<\/p>\n<p>Released in April, <em>Blue Prince<\/em> was the best-reviewed game of 2025 when it came out, with an aggregate score of 90 on Opencritic. While it didn&#8217;t hold that crown forever, it&#8217;s still near the top of the year&#8217;s highest-rated games. A lot of console players have already had access to <em>Blue Prince<\/em> due to its day-one inclusion on both Xbox Game Pass and PlayStation Plus, but those looking to hold onto it forever can use the Winter Sale to add <em>Blue Prince<\/em> to their Steam libraries permanently.<\/p>\n<p>    <!-- No AdsNinja v10 Client! --><\/p>\n<h2 id=\"megabonk---7-49-25-off\">\n            <span class=\"item-num\">3 <\/span><br \/>\n        <span><br \/>\n                            Megabonk &#8211; $7.49 (25% Off)<br \/>\n                    <\/span><br \/>\n       <\/h2>\n<p>If <em>Blue Prince<\/em> is too peaceful and thought-provoking, the <em>Megabonk<\/em> discount on Steam provides gamers with some chaotic battles against hordes of enemies and ridiculous level scaling. Released in September, <em>Megabonk <\/em>registers at 94 percent approval on Steam, and its regular price tag of under $10 is cut even cheaper with its inclusion in the Winter Sale.<\/p>\n<p>Fans of <em>Vampire Survivors<\/em> have flocked to try out <em>Megabonk<\/em>&#8216;s cast of characters, and they&#8217;ll recognize a similar gameplay loop as they wipe out waves of enemies with randomly received power-ups. It may have gotten special attention for withdrawing consideration from The Game Awards 2025 over a technicality, but plenty of fans feel it deserved a shot at the podium.<\/p>\n<p>    <!-- No AdsNinja v10 Client! --><\/p>\n<h2 id=\"red-dead-redemption-2---14-99-75-off\">\n            <span class=\"item-num\">2 <\/span><br \/>\n        <span><br \/>\n                            Red Dead Redemption 2 &#8211; $14.99 (75% Off)<br \/>\n                    <\/span><br \/>\n       <\/h2>\n<p>The Winter Sale also includes a sizable discount on <em>Red Dead Redemption 2<\/em>. The classic Western action-adventure game has been around since 2018, but it&#8217;s another game that falls into the category of timeless hit, and it&#8217;s being offered as a steal for anyone who has avoided it this long.<\/p>\n<p>Following the story of outlaw Arthur Morgan, the turn-of-the-century tale of the Van der Linde gang is one of the most celebrated in all gaming. <em>Red Dead Redemption 2<\/em> racked up Game of the Year honors from more than 175 different sources, and while it lost out to <em>God of War<\/em> at The Game Awards 2018, it&#8217;s still a hot property for Rockstar Games that has fans asking if they will ever get a <em>Red Dead Redemption 3<\/em>.<\/p>\n<p>    <!-- No AdsNinja v10 Client! --><\/p>\n<h2 id=\"dave-the-diver---10-99-45-off\">\n            <span class=\"item-num\">1 <\/span><br \/>\n        <span><br \/>\n                            Dave the Diver &#8211; $10.99 (45% Off)<br \/>\n                    <\/span><br \/>\n       <\/h2>\n<p>It may be a couple of years old at this point, but <em>Dave the Diver<\/em> is still getting DLCs in 2025, keeping the combination of action-adventure and restaurant management sim feeling fresh. Developed by Mintrocket, <em>Dave the Diver<\/em> sits at an all-time approval rating of 96 percent on Steam, making it one of the best-received games on this list.<\/p>\n<p>Presented through an intentionally pixelated art style, players guide Dave through deep-sea dives during the day before switching to running a sushi restaurant featuring the day&#8217;s haul at night.
